Before we get into the different must-haves for your baby girl’s winter closet, consider the following: 

If your child is a toddler, she probably has a lot of energy to burn and is constantly on the move. In such a case, you do not want to pile layers upon layers around her – that would make it difficult for her to be as mobile as she would like to be. 
Think of your toddler as a mini-version of yourself. If you are feeling chilly in one sweatshirt, there’s a good chance she feels cold too. 
Layering thin and loose clothes works better than throwing on a heavy jacket.
Whatever you choose, make sure your baby girl’s hands and ears are covered properly.

Beanies are basic baby dress girl accessories that you cannot do without. Get cute colourful beanies that are big enough to cover her ears. These can be made of wool, cashmere or fleece. Along with beanies, cute mittens that cover their hands and keep them warm are super important. Frostbite is a serious issue during winter in most countries in the north. Mittens are a good accessory to prevent that. 

Consider buying knit hats that are made of wool or cashmere too. Some such caps are made of fleece-lined cotton as well, so the options are endless. If they have ear flaps, they are even better. These can keep your baby girl warm and cosy. If they don’t have ear flaps, not to worry, you can pair these knit caps with cute ear muffs made of faux fur. 

Woollen scarves are another must-have for the winter baby dress girl closet. Only, you’ll have to take care to ensure they are not too thick and heavy. Choose water-resistant parkas and fleece-lined jackets that are not too heavy but are still cosy and warm. Your baby girl can wear a hoodie under such a jacket for added insulation. If a heavy coat is all you have for her, then make sure that when you are inside a car,  you are removing the heavy coat and replacing it with a warm blanket or scarf. You can also just use a windbreaker instead of a heavy coat. 

If you live in a region where it snows, then snow boots and waterproof ski gloves are also needed to properly insulate your baby girl so she can continue playing outdoors without worry.
